Pair of fawns in painted earthenware with polychrome underglaze enamels. Milan, mid-1930s. Manufacturer: Cacciapuoti stoneware of art
Dimensions in cm 16.3 x 22
Country of origin: FI (Firenze) Italia
Guido Cacciapuoti, born in 1892 in Italy, was an esteemed ceramic artist and sculptor renowned for his exquisite porcelain creations.
